About ethyl 6-methyl-5-oxo-1-phenyl-[1,2,4]triazolo[3,4-c][1,2,4]triazine-3-carboxylate
ethyl 6-methyl-5-oxo-1-phenyl-[1,2,4]triazolo[3,4-c][1,2,4]triazine-3-carboxylate (PubChem CID 1234430) has the molecular formula C14H13N5O3
and a molecular weight of 299.29 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is ethyl 6-methyl-5-oxo-1-phenyl-[1,2,4]triazolo[3,4-c][1,2,4]triazine-3-carboxylate.

What is the SMILES notation for ethyl 6-methyl-5-oxo-1-phenyl-[1,2,4]triazolo[3,4-c][1,2,4]triazine-3-carboxylate?
The canonical SMILES for ethyl 6-methyl-5-oxo-1-phenyl-[1,2,4]triazolo[3,4-c][1,2,4]triazine-3-carboxylate is CCOC(=O)c1nn(-c2ccccc2)c2nnc(C)c(=O)n12.
What is the InChIKey of ethyl 6-methyl-5-oxo-1-phenyl-[1,2,4]triazolo[3,4-c][1,2,4]triazine-3-carboxylate?
The InChIKey is REOGQHQMOJCMAI-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C14H13N5O3/c1-3-22-13(21)11-17-19(10-7-5-4-6-8-10)14-16-15-9(2)12(20)18(11)14/h4-8H,3H2,1-2H3.
What are the key properties of ethyl 6-methyl-5-oxo-1-phenyl-[1,2,4]triazolo[3,4-c][1,2,4]triazine-3-carboxylate?
ethyl 6-methyl-5-oxo-1-phenyl-[1,2,4]triazolo[3,4-c][1,2,4]triazine-3-carboxylate has a molecular weight of 299.29 g/mol, XLogP of 0.76, 3 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 8 hydrogen bond acceptors.
